Installing a septic system on uneven terrain presents unique challenges that require careful planning and expertise. Uneven or sloped land can impact the flow of wastewater, making it crucial to design a system that accommodates the natural topography while ensuring efficient waste management. One of the primary considerations is ensuring proper gravity flow within the septic system. On uneven terrain, the slope can cause wastewater to flow too quickly or stagnate in certain areas, leading to inefficiencies and potential backups. A professional installer can use techniques such as stepped trenches or pressure distribution systems to manage these challenges effectively. Drain field placement is another critical factor. Sloped land often requires specially designed drain fields to ensure even water distribution and prevent soil erosion. Installing barriers or retaining walls may be necessary to stabilize the area and protect the system. Choosing the right type of septic system is vital for uneven terrain. Mound systems or aerobic treatment units (ATUs) are commonly used in such scenarios as they provide greater flexibility for handling variations in elevation. Soil testing is essential to evaluate drainage capabilities and ensure the system complies with local regulations. Additionally, considering potential surface runoff and its impact on the septic system is crucial for long-term performance.
